Explain Methods of Protein Estimation?
Several methods for protein estimation are available. These methods are based on several analytical characteristics of the protein. Laboratory estimation of protein is based on any of the following principles:
i) Nitrogen estimation based on the principle of Kjeldahl's method,
ii) Estimation of tyrosine in protein (as in Lowry's method) or both phenyl alanine and tyrosine in protein (Folin's method).
iii) Biuret method - most commonly used method in clinical practice and teaching laboratories.
We have studied some of the tests in qualitative methods and the principle is the same. The Biuret method for example can be used for both qualitative and quantitative estimation of proteins.
